I am having the same exact problem, as are many others from what I gather. It seems that the switch has made it impossible for people to get diamonds without a key/voucher. I have been wanting to buy diamonds via credit card and am getting the same problem where I cannot get to a "server selection" or payment method other than key/voucher. I do not have either a key or a voucher so that point is moot.
Just throwing this out there, but it seems kind of silly that the way the game makes money off people's purchases is down. I mean it seems like they would want to make sure this is one of the main features that are working correctly!